Abstract

Optimum crop yield is greatly affected by proper planting and sowing times. The objective of this research was to develop an algorithm that uses the heat unit concept to determine the most suitable planting times for vegetable crops. The developed algorithm was programmed in a database environment with sample climatic data for the Kingdom of Saudi Arabia. The model was tested by validation (comparison to experts' estimations), verification (statistical comparison to formal published data), and evaluation (by professionals, landowners, and farmers). The overall results of the model were highly acceptable. The model needs more verification and validation in different environments and with various crops.
